Backstory[edit]

I think it is important to put Carol's backstory on the page. Carol and David did go to the same school, as mentioned by Derek and also it was because Derek terrorised the Wickses, that the Wicks family fled in 1976 (remember, Lou Beale mentioned when Simon entered the Square, that she had not seen him in almost 10 years, and that was late 1985). Also, it is mentioned that Derek, Jack and Max were raised in East London and it is pretty clear that the Wickses lived in Walford at the time so it is important to mention that Carol is an East Ender. — Preceding unsigned comment added by 195.171.221.67 (talk) 20:47, 20 January 2012 (UTC)[reply]
